Abstract
本发明涉及一种有机食品果蔬专用防霉设备,本装置包括箱体、进风口、轴流风机、纳米涂层除尘过滤网、静电除尘除菌过滤网、紫外杀菌除菌装置、超声恒湿器、电子制冷机、环状电磁场、臭氧,I+、I‑离子发生器等部分。本发明利用装置内循环系统,对库内的空气进行循环除尘、杀菌,不使用任何保鲜剂,适用于有机食品果蔬保鲜。果蔬入库时,利用库内冷源,对果蔬进行恒湿差压预冷,提高预冷效率,保证果蔬贮藏品质。
Description
技术领域
本发明属于防腐保鲜领域,尤其是一种有机食品果蔬专用防腐设备。
背景技术
现有的果蔬保鲜一般采用冷库结合保鲜剂和防腐剂进行协同保鲜,根据实测,冷库在运行中耗能较大,且冷量得不到有效的循环,对库内的果蔬保鲜效果有待提高。保鲜剂和防腐剂的使用增加了水果除农药外,其他残留物的增加,增加食用的安全隐患,需要提供一种新的防腐设备,来减少和降低保鲜剂和防腐剂的使用,增加果蔬在长时间保鲜过程中的口感。
发明内容
本发明是为了克服现有技术的不足之处,提供一种结构新颖、使用方法简单、防腐效果好的有机食品果蔬专用防腐设备。
本发明实现目的的技术方案如下:
一种有机食品果蔬专用防霉设备,包括气体处理箱体以及风机,气体处理箱体的一侧制有进气口,另一侧制有出气口,出气口安装风机,风机用于将外部气体循环进入气体处理箱体内,通过气体处理箱的净化、加湿、电离等处理后循环进入冷库,在冷库内贮藏期间流相内循环;
所述气体处理箱体的内部结构为:在进气口与出气口之间的箱体上壁和箱体下壁直接安装有安装架,在安装架上制有多个卡槽,以及装置所需的电源接口,以供下述设备能够顺利安装,正常运转,在安装架上由进气口侧至出气口侧依次平行间隔安装有:纳米涂层除尘过滤网、静电除尘除菌过滤网、紫外杀菌除菌装置、超声恒湿器、电子制冷机、环状电磁场、臭氧,I+、I-离子发生器。
而且,在气体处理箱体箱体内或者箱体下部安装一水槽,该水槽为超声恒湿器供水,接收来自电子制冷装置结露生成的水。
而且,所述出气口直接连接冷库的进气口。
而且,所述气体处理箱体箱体气密,箱体后盖可拆卸。
本发明的优点和积极效果如下:
1、本发明提供的防腐设备在冷库贮藏期间可以为冷库提供流相(气体)内循环,果蔬封闭环境风内循环(介质相流动,即流相)具有显著防霉作用,如同流水不腐户枢不蠹一样。精确控制环境流相,不使用任何防腐保鲜剂,解决有机食品防腐保鲜难题。
2、本发明提供的防腐设备可以帮助果蔬入库快速差压预冷,解决果蔬预冷效率低、失水难题,红提葡萄预冷量8吨,温度由25℃降至0-1℃,用时6h。预冷效率提高40%-60%,库内气体净化率99%。
3、本发明提供的防腐设备的箱体气密性良好,箱体后盖可拆,方便维修,箱体参考尺寸,高×宽×厚=高2200mm×宽1500mm×厚500mm,进风口尺寸0.6m×1.6m,箱体底部带有万向轮,可以移动,轴流风机风量为库容积的15-20倍(5000-6000m3/h)。

具体实施方式
下面通过具体实施例对本发明作进一步详述,以下实施例只是描述性的,不是限定性的,不能以此限定本发明的保护范围。
一种有机食品果蔬专用防霉设备,包括气体处理箱体2以及风机3,气体处理箱体的一侧制有进气口1,另一侧制有出气口,出气口安装风机,风机用于将外部气体循环进入气体处理箱体内,通过气体处理箱的净化、加湿、电离等处理后循环进入冷库,在冷库内贮藏期间流相内循环,果蔬封闭环境风内循环(介质相流动,即流相)具有显著防霉作用,如同流水不腐户枢不蠹一样。精确控制环境流相,不使用任何防腐保鲜剂,解决有机食品防腐保鲜难题。
所述气体处理箱体的内部结构为:在进气口与出气口之间的箱体上壁和箱体下壁直接安装有安装架4,在安装架上制有多个卡槽,以及装置所需的电源接口等(本申请没有标号),以供下述设备能够顺利安装,正常运转,在安装架上由进气口侧至出气口侧依次平行间隔安装有:纳米涂层除尘过滤网5、静电除尘除菌过滤网6、紫外杀菌除菌装置7、超声恒湿器8、电子制冷机9、环状电磁场10、臭氧,I+、I-离子发生器11。
本申请在箱体内或者箱体下部安装一水槽12,该水槽为超声恒湿器供水,同时还可以接收来自电子制冷装置结露生成的水,供水和接水分别采用管道连接,本申请不做特殊限制。
出气口直接连接冷库的进气口,能够保证库体内进入气体的绝对的纯净度、湿度以及无菌度,保证库体内的无菌恒湿环境,延长库体内果蔬的保鲜时间。
本发明提供的防腐设备的箱体气密性良好,箱体后盖可拆,方便维修,箱体参考尺寸,高×宽×厚=高2200mm×宽1500mm×厚500mm,进风口尺寸0.6m×1.6m,箱体底部带有万向轮,可以移动,轴流风机风量为库容积的15-20倍(5000-6000m3/h)。
上述装置的作用及参考型号如下:
1、气体处理箱体:常规镀锌铁皮,厚度1mm,喷漆,箱外形参考尺寸:高2200mm×宽1500mm×厚500mm。静压箱底部侧面安装带有万向轮地脚,其中,每侧有一个轮可以制动,轮距1000mm,方便移动和拆卸。箱体接缝处做气密处理,目的是为了产生最大的压力差。
2、轴流风机:380V轴流风机,风量5000-6000m3/h,功率0.75KW,可参考选购上海风机电器有限公司生产的哈莱申牌低噪声轴流风机,型号为SF NO 3.5号。
3、进风口:尺寸:宽600mm×高1600mm。
4、箱体后盖(维修门):整体可拆,作为检修门,打开后可以看到设备内部各部分结构。
5、水槽:为超声加湿装置提供水源,同时可以接收电子制冷装置结露生成的水。
6、纳米涂层除尘过滤网:除杂质,除灰尘。采用粒径在20nm以下,呈球形的银粒子经特殊工艺与过滤网相结合生产而成,厚度3-50mm,可使用HEPA型高效过滤网。
7、静电除尘除菌过滤网:利用高压静电场,吸附气体流中带电尘粒和菌类。可选用中纺/zflc-hepa型号静电除尘网。
8、紫外杀菌除菌装置:紫外杀菌。使用波长UVC(200~280nm)的电磁波杀菌,灯212mm,功率8W,电流270Ma,紫外辐照度26uw/cm2,可使用HDGW212D/S15型号紫外灯。
9、超声恒湿器:加湿作用,加湿量3000-5000ml/h,雾粒直径1-5微米,可选用正岛SJ-J3000型加湿器。
10、电子制冷机:使用半导体制冷,半导体制冷器具有无噪声、无振动、不需制冷剂、体积小、重量轻等特点,且工作可靠,操作简便,易于进行冷量调节。制冷,保持恒温和除湿作用。制冷量20-50W,稳定电流2-4A,电压12-24V,冷面长60-80mm,宽40-60mm,高10-12mm,热面长80-160mm,宽60-120mm,高50-70mm。可使用型号ATP050-12-A-00型。
11、环状电磁场:材料使用软磁性材料,切割气流,初吸力8000N-10000N,工作电压24V,可选用力迅/LX-26540型。
12、臭氧,I+、I-离子发生器:离子浓度3×106PCS/cm3,臭氧浓度60-80mg/L,可选用CL-R03正负离子发生器。
